- Alzheimer's disease (AD) is linked to chronic periodontitis (CP), but the molecular mechanisms are unclear.
- Huanglian Jiedu Decoction (HLJDD) was studied for its effects on CP-induced AD using machine learning and multi-omics.
- Single-cell RNA-sequencing showed inflammatory activation in microglia from AD samples.
- A CP-induced AD rat model was created, and hippocampal transcriptomic profiling was performed.
- Machine learning strategies identified the cGAS-STING pathway as central to CP-AD pathology.
- HLJDD suppressed cGAS-STING activation, reduced neuroinflammation, and improved cognitive function in CP-induced AD models.
- The study highlights machine learning's role in mechanistic prioritization and HLJDD as a potential therapy for CP-induced AD.
